Tizio Table Lamp
Tizio Table Lamp, a timeless icon of Italian design, the Tizio Table Lamp by Richard Sapper for Artemide (1972) is a masterclass in form and function. Recognised globally and featured in MoMA and The Metās permanent collections, it revolutionised task lighting with its counterweight system and wire-free design. Its sleek arms double as electrical conductors, while the fully adjustable structure allows precise, balanced light direction with effortless motion.
